  The 100-watt laser machine is pretty handy at manufacturing hubs but it is a favorite among hobbyists as well. You can use it to cut through lots of materials for your home-based laser engraving business. But what exactly can a 100 watt laser cut?

  A 100-watt CO2 laser cutter will cut a 12mm thick sheet of acrylic like a stick of butter. That is why it’s commonly used in industries associated with plastic fabrication and in the wood industries. You can also use it to cut materials like cardboard, leather, rubber and more. You will need at least 300 Watts to cut thin metals.

  Paper, cardstock, and cardboard are effortlessly cut by a 100-watt laser, allowing for intricate patterns, custom packaging, and artistic projects. The laser provides precision for thin materials like:

  A 100-watt laser can also cut through natural and synthetic rubber materials up to 6mm (0.24 inches) thick. This capability is widely used for creating gaskets, stamps, and industrial seals.

  A 100-watt CO2 laser cannot cut metals directly, but it can engrave coated metals or use a marking agent for engraving on bare metals. However, fiber lasers, rather than CO2 lasers, are more commonly used for cutting metals.

  Laser engraving involves using a focused laser beam to remove material from the surface of an object, creating intricate designs, text, or images. Unlike laser cutting, which penetrates completely through the material, engraving is typically a surface-level process. This technique is widely used on various materials, including wood, acrylic, glass, leather, and metal.
